science Is it safe to use Vinegar on my car?
  • Vinegar can be used for cleaning windows, deodorizing, and as a deicer when diluted properly.
  • Mix 3 parts water to 1 part vinegar for general cleaning; use a towel to wipe interior surfaces.
  • As a deicer, mix 3 parts vinegar to 1 part water and spray on your windshield to help with frost.
warning Avoid using undiluted vinegar on paint, screens, or sensitive electronics. Always test on a small, hidden area first to ensure compatibility with your car’s surfaces.
eco Is Baking Soda a deodorizer?
  • Baking soda is a natural deodorizer; sprinkle on floor mats and vacuum for a fresh scent.
  • Mix into a paste to clean dirty seat belts: apply, gently scrub, rinse, and air dry.
  • Always use non-abrasive cleaners on seatbelts to protect fabric integrity.
light_mode What can I use to clean my headlights?
  • Toothpaste can help remove yellowing and cloudiness from headlight covers.
  • Apply toothpaste with a towel, rub in a circular motion, cover entire surface, then rinse.
  • Use non-gel toothpaste for best results.
spa Is there a natural product that is a leather conditioner?
  • Coconut oil can be used as a natural leather conditioner.
  • Wipe leather clean, dry, then apply coconut oil with a cloth for a refreshed look and scent.
  • Test on a small area first to ensure compatibility with your leather finish.
